PALAU COMPACT
ROAD
Republic of Palau
U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Honolulu District
Surveying Services:
RMTC surveyors provided survey services for the entire 53 miles of
the proposed highway. A global positioning system (GPS) was used
to stake out the road's baseline, followed by topographic and cadastral
surveying. RMTC field personnel used Palauan guides to assist in
clearing the initial alignment.

Engineering Services:
RMTC engineers provided overall coordination and civil design of an
85 kilometer, two lane road on the island of Babeldaob. The design of the
road included over-coming valleys, cliffs, and swamps. The design also
includes a 1 kilometer causeway across a boat harbor. |
